Key Components of a Premium Coffee Hamper

Coffee Selection

    Single-origin vs. blends: Single-origin offers a unique flavor profile; blends provide balanced consistency. Roast level: Light roasts highlight acidity; dark roasts bring chocolatey richness. Freshness: Look for beans roasted within the last month and sealed in airtight packaging.

Complementary Items

    Coffee accessories: French press, pour‑over dripper, or a sleek espresso machine. Sweeteners and flavorings: Organic honey, vanilla beans, or a small jar of sea salt. Gourmet snacks: Dark chocolate, biscotti, or artisanal crackers to pair with the brew.

Presentation and Packaging

    Basket or wooden crate: A sturdy, reusable container adds a touch of elegance. Decorative wrapping: Natural fibers, twine, or a tasteful ribbon can elevate the look. Personalized note: A handwritten card turns the hamper into a heartfelt experience.

Practical Tips for Selecting the Coffee

Roast Profiles and Flavor Notes

    Light roast: Citrus, floral notes—great for those who like a bright cup. Medium roast: Balanced, nutty, slightly sweet—ideal for everyday enjoyment. Dark roast: Rich, smoky, chocolatey—perfect for espresso lovers.

Bean Origin and Sustainability

    Ethical sourcing: Look for certifications like Fair Trade or Rainforest Alliance. Regional specialties: Ethiopian Yirgacheffe, Colombian Supremo, or Guatemalan Antigua each bring distinct flavors.

Packaging Size and Shelf Life

    Half-pound bags: Good for regular use. Quarter-pound packs: Ideal for a single gift or sampling.

Budgeting and Value

Price Ranges and What to Expect

    Budget (under $50): Small bags, basic accessories, and a simple basket. Mid‑range ($50–$120): Larger coffee bags, premium accessories, and a decorative crate. Luxury (above $120): High‑grade beans, artisan accessories, and a custom‑made basket.

Deals and Seasonal Offers

    Holiday sales: Look for bundle discounts during Black Friday or Cyber Monday. Subscription boxes: Some services offer a premium coffee hamper as a one‑time gift.
